Northeast Advanced Technological Education Center (NEATEC) Community College Internship
Designed for community college students, this internship integrates workforce training and professional development with applied experience in semiconductor and nanotechnology fields. Through partnerships with higher education and industry, NEATEC prepares you for high-tech careers with modern, industry-relevant skills.
National Science Foundation (NSF) Energy Storage Engine in Upstate New York Internship
These internships offer two pathways for college students:
- A stipend-paid undergraduate research experience where you work on a 10-week research project at a partner university.
- An hourly-paid industrial internship with an NSF industry partner focused on real-world applications of your studies.
Both experiences are designed to deepen your technical expertise and expand your professional network.
P3I Hawaii Internships
P3I Hawaii connects college students to a range of defense and technology-focused opportunities, including paid internships, fellowships, and research experiences with organizations like NSA, Booz Allen Hamilton, INDOPACOM, and the Department of War. These programs offer hands-on learning, mentorship, and pathways to careers in national security, engineering, and cybersecurity.
